Japanese Navy submarine prepares to depart on a mission from base in South Pacific during World War 2

Palm trees and hills form a Pacific Island background. Crew of a Japanese Navy submarine stand in formation on the boat's deck, as their captain informs them of their orders. Several views of the sub and its crew. Following the Captain's briefing, crew members proceed to their respective duty stations. The submarine's engines start and the wake from propeller is seen. The submarine departs from the dock, while crew wave to others who wave back from the shore. The boat proceeds slowly out of the harbor.

Admiral Halsey bestowing Navy Crosses in South Pacific port.

Crew of destroyer lined up for presentation of Navy Crosses by Admiral Halsey in South Pacific port. Line of sailors and officers at attention. Crew of ship cheering. Admiral Halsey speaking aboard ship. Admiral Halsey pinning Navy Cross on Commander Arnold Ellsworth True, Commander of the Destroyer USS Hammond. Presentation of Navy Cross to Commander Wallace Frederick Peterson. Presentation of Silver Star to Seaman 1st class O S Downey. Admiral Halsey leaving ship. Halsey ascending ship gangway to dock.
